Alphatec (NASDAQ:ATEC) (NASDAQ: ATEC) is a medical technology company focused on the development and commercialization of advanced spinal surgical products. The company’s mission centers on delivering safe, reproducible, and less invasive solutions for patients undergoing spinal fusion procedures. By integrating implants, instruments, and biologics into cohesive platforms, Alphatec aims to standardize minimally invasive techniques and improve clinical outcomes.
The company’s core product portfolio includes spinal implants, surgical instruments, and biologic materials designed for minimally invasive lateral, posterior and anterior lumbar interbody fusion approaches. Alphatec’s flagship platforms—such as the Zevo lateral system and the Trestle posterior system—combine proprietary retraction, implant delivery and neuromonitoring technologies to streamline workflow while preserving soft tissue. Its biologic offerings, including synthetic ceramics and allograft extenders, support robust fusion and bone healing.
Headquartered in Carlsbad, California, Alphatec serves spine surgeons and healthcare facilities throughout the United States, Europe and select international markets. The company maintains a direct sales and clinical support organization domestically, complemented by distributor partnerships overseas. Collaborations with leading academic medical centers and participation in multicenter clinical trials underpin Alphatec’s commitment to evidence‐based innovation and global regulatory clearances.
